# Copyright 1999-2021 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=8 KDE_ORG_COMMIT=33693a928986006d79c1ee743733cde5966ac402 QT5_MODULE="qttools" inherit qt5-build DESCRIPTION="Qt documentation generator" if [[ ${QT5_BUILD_TYPE} == release ]]; then KEYWORDS="amd64 ~arm arm64 ~ppc64 ~riscv x86" fi IUSE="qml" DEPEND=" =dev-qt/qtcore-${QT5_PV}*:5= sys-devel/clang:= qml? ( =dev-qt/qtdeclarative-${QT5_PV}* ) " RDEPEND="${DEPEND}" QT5_TARGET_SUBDIRS=( src/qdoc ) src_prepare() { qt_use_disable_mod qml qmldevtools-private \ src/qdoc/qdoc.pro qt5-build_src_prepare } src_configure() { # qt5_tools_configure() not enough here, needs another fix, bug 676948 mkdir -p "${QT5_BUILD_DIR}"/src/qdoc || die qt5_qmake "${QT5_BUILD_DIR}" cp src/qdoc/qtqdoc-config.pri "${QT5_BUILD_DIR}"/src/qdoc || die qt5-build_src_configure }